Transaction 95739ba7b5eedaa4cd5cdbdfbc14036a928c0307fafc6735a243e4233621201a

2 Input
2 Outputs
  • 95739ba7b5eedaa4cd5cdbdfbc14036a928c0307fafc6735a243e4233621201a:0
  • value  1651697
    address  2N1d1g57kCdYUeZ42zh6c4WUnbtjkUL1t2H
  • 95739ba7b5eedaa4cd5cdbdfbc14036a928c0307fafc6735a243e4233621201a:1
  • value  1244406
    address  mpu6rE73L8E6JckiJFyQ7RtCBMDaongV1e